Drainage and Erosion Control

Design and Maintenance Considerations for Erosion Control on Local Roads

This workshop covers the many elements of erosion control for local roads, including regulations and permit requirements and treatment selection for given areas and phases of construction. In addition, the installation and maintenance of treatment options are outlined. The course is geared mainly to those responsible for designing roadway projects and developing erosion control plans as required by the NPDES permits.
